Here's my thirdgen birds

1989 GTA, bought from the original owner in 1997 and was an L98 automatic but now has a stockish 3.8L Turbo and runs 10.50 @ 128mph on C16 and 11.06 @ 120mph on straight 93 octane. Was also featured in the May 2007 issue of GMHTP


TTA#124, 1 of 187 cloth/t-top cars built and is also Indy Festival car #96. Went through a mini frame on resto right before the 2009 Hot Rod Power Tour and will be at the T/A Nats next week.


TTA#850, 1 of 1,324 leather/t-top cars built it's a bone stock 62K mile car that I've had scince the late 90's. Was on the cover of the Dec 2005 issue of GMHTP and scince then has gone 13.37 @ 103.85mph. Not bad for a stock 20 year old V6


TTA#884, 1 of 15 cloth/hardtop cars built. Drove it home from Reno in 2002 and is stock with 52K miles. The sun out west wasnt too nice to it and the paint is a bit faded and will get a repaint but for now I just enjoy owning/driving such a rare car.


Hope you guys like, I'm new to fourth gens and this site but been around thirdgens as long as I can remember.

Heres another amazing 3rd gen . Hopefully the guy doesnt mind pics being posted over here . The back 1/2 of the car was widened by 1" in similar fashion a the 90-95 ZR1 was . The body shop did an amazing job , it looks factory . Other tid bits 454 LSx , t56 18x12 iforged wheels in the rear with 335 tires . I posted a link to the ongoing build thread over @ thirdgen.org . If u ever have some time to kill , the thread is 40 some pages long with about 1700 posts I posted a few pics below , theres MANY more of all the stages of fabrication in the original thread .
